Understanding Core Workflow Components
Before diving into the specifics, it’s crucial to understand the fundamental components of a typical workflow. Workflows are the backbone of any organization, representing the sequence of tasks and activities required to deliver a product or service. These workflows often involve multiple departments, individuals, and systems, making them susceptible to inefficiencies and errors. Identifying these pain points is the first step toward achieving improvement. A common mistake is attempting to overhaul an entire workflow at once. Instead, a phased approach, focusing on the most critical bottlenecks, often yields better results and minimizes disruption. Effective workflow management isn't about adding more steps; it’s about optimizing the existing ones and ensuring seamless communication between teams.
The Role of Automation
Automation plays a vital role in modern workflow management. Tasks that are repetitive, rule-based, and time-consuming are ideal candidates for automation. This frees up valuable human resources to focus on more strategic and creative work. There are a variety of automation tools available, ranging from Robotic Process Automation (RPA) to sophisticated business process management (BPM) systems. The key is to choose the right tools for the job and to integrate them effectively with existing systems. It’s also important to remember that not all processes should be automated; some tasks require human judgment and critical thinking. Well-implemented automation isn’t about replacing people; it’s about augmenting their capabilities.
| Workflow Component | Potential Bottlenecks | Automation Opportunities |
|---|---|---|
| Data Entry | Manual errors, time consumption | RPA, Optical Character Recognition (OCR) |
| Approval Processes | Delays due to multiple approvals | Automated routing, digital signatures |
| Reporting | Manual data collection and analysis | Automated report generation, data visualization tools |
| Customer Support | Long wait times, repetitive inquiries | Chatbots, automated email responses |
The table above provides a simplified view of common workflow components, potential issues, and ways to address them through automation. Analyzing your specific workflows along these lines can help pinpoint areas for immediate improvement. Remember to always prioritize tasks based on their impact on overall efficiency and customer satisfaction.

Integrating Systems for Seamless Data Flow
One of the biggest challenges organizations face is data silos – isolated systems that don’t communicate with each other. This leads to data duplication, inconsistencies, and inefficiencies. Integrating these systems is crucial for creating a seamless flow of information. Application Programming Interfaces (APIs) allow different systems to exchange data automatically, eliminating the need for manual data entry. Data integration isn’t a one-time project; it’s an ongoing process that requires continuous monitoring and maintenance. Effective data integration is the foundation of a truly optimized workflow.

The Importance of Process Analysis and Optimization
Before implementing any changes, it’s crucial to conduct a thorough process analysis. This involves mapping out existing workflows, identifying bottlenecks, and pinpointing areas for improvement. There are a variety of tools and techniques that can be used for process analysis, such as flowcharts, process mapping software, and value stream mapping. The goal is to gain a clear understanding of how work is currently done and to identify opportunities to make it more efficient. Don’t be afraid to challenge assumptions and question existing processes. Sometimes the most effective solutions are the simplest ones. Furthermore, continuous process optimization is vital – workflows should be regularly reviewed and refined to ensure they remain aligned with evolving business needs.
Utilizing Key Performance Indicators (KPIs)
Key Performance Indicators (KPIs) are measurable values that demonstrate how effectively a company is achieving key business objectives. When it comes to workflow optimization, relevant KPIs might include cycle time, error rate, customer satisfaction, and cost per transaction. Regularly monitoring these KPIs provides valuable insights into the effectiveness of workflow improvements. It also allows you to identify areas where further optimization is needed. It’s important to choose KPIs that are aligned with your overall business goals and to track them consistently over time. KPIs aren't just about measuring success; they're about driving continuous improvement.

Exploring Synergies with Agile Methodologies
The principles underpinning boostwin align well with Agile methodologies, specifically frameworks like Scrum and Kanban. These iterative and incremental approaches to project management emphasize flexibility, collaboration, and rapid response to change. By incorporating Agile practices, organizations can break down large projects into smaller, manageable sprints, allowing for frequent feedback and course correction. This iterative process is particularly valuable in dynamic environments where requirements are constantly evolving. The focus on delivering value incrementally and continuously refining processes directly complements the goals of workflow optimization. Utilizing these synergies can create a powerful engine for innovation and efficiency.
Consider a scenario where a marketing team is launching a new campaign. Instead of following a traditional waterfall approach with a lengthy planning phase followed by execution, they could adopt a Scrum framework. Each sprint might focus on a specific aspect of the campaign, such as content creation, social media promotion, or email marketing. Regular sprint reviews would allow the team to gather feedback and make adjustments, ensuring that the campaign stays on track and delivers the desired results. This adaptive approach, facilitated by Agile principles, exemplifies how strategic methodologies can elevate workflow effectiveness and create a dynamic, responsive organization.
